What is the correct sequence in a simple food chain?
AProducer → Consumer → Decomposer
BConsumer → Producer → Decomposer
CDecomposer → Producer → Consumer
DConsumer → Decomposer → Producer
Step-by-Step Solution
  1. Step 1: Understand food chain sequence

    A food chain starts with producers (plants), followed by consumers (herbivores/carnivores), and ends with decomposers.
  2. Step 2: Analyze options

    Only the sequence Producer → Consumer → Decomposer correctly represents energy flow.
  3. Final Answer:

    Producer → Consumer → Decomposer → Option A
  4. Quick Check:

    Food chain sequence = Producer → Consumer → Decomposer ✅
Quick Trick: Remember: Energy flows from plants to animals to decomposers.
Common Mistakes:
  • Mixing order of decomposers and consumers.
